Fabio Fognini vs Tommy Paul Prediction - French Open 2024

Fabio Fognini will play Tommy Paul in the second round of the French Open Men's Singles 2024 on Friday.

Stats Insider's best betting tips for the Fognini vs Paul match, plus the latest betting odds in Australia, are detailed in this article.

Who Will Win: Fognini vs Paul

Based on advanced machine learning and data, Stats Insider has simulated the result of Friday's Fognini-Paul men's singles match 10,000 times.

Our independent predictive analytics model currently gives Paul an 82% chance of beating Fognini in the French Open Men's Singles 2024.
